Music Festival:
BB&T Concert Band Competition
The 42nd annual Concert Band Competition will begin at 8 a.m. Friday, May 3, on the campus of Shenandoah University in Winchester.
Schools are divided into classifications according to the grade level and difficulty of the music performed. Each band is required to perform three selections within a 30-minute period, and two of those selections must be chosen from the Virginia Band and Orchestra Directors’ graded music list. Competition Information
Performance Schedule
By classification, beginning
with Class C and concluding with Class A.
Competition starts at 8:00 a.m.
Entrance
Limited to one band per school unless space permits.
Fee
$100.00 per band.
Classification
Determined by the lowest grade level piece performed for adjudication.
- Class A Music Grade VI
- Class B Music Grade V & VI
- Class C Music Grade IV, V & VI
- Middle school and junior high school bands will perform for ratings
and
comments only.
Performance Requirements
Each band is judged on three selections. One selection may be a march
or other nongraded selection, while the two must be chosen from the
Virginia Band and Orchestra Directors Association music list which
will be forwarded upon acceptance.
Evaluation
By three adjudicators.
Awards
Bands achieving a Rating I will receive an award for that accomplishment.
Bands receiving I and II ratings will be eligible for the following awards:
- The
Shenandoah Cup for the outstanding band.
- The President’s Award for the band achieving the second highest point total regardless of
classification.
- The Director’s Award for the band achieving
the third highest point total regardless of classification.
First, Second and Third place awards are presented in each classification.
Bands will receive individual score sheets and a cassette recording of
each judge’s comments.
